Online gambling involves wagering on games, sports, and other events through the internet. This type of gambling is more convenient than traditional gambling as it eliminates the need to travel. It also allows people to gamble at any time of day or night. However, this convenience comes with some risks. This article aims to highlight some of the key issues surrounding this form of gambling.

The first thing to consider when choosing an online casino is whether or not it’s legal in your jurisdiction. In many countries, it is illegal to place real-money wagers on online casinos unless they’re licensed in your state. In the US, for example, there are several states that license and regulate online casinos.
